MEMPHIS-Visiting Lyon scored the equalizer with just 38 seconds remaining to force overtime Friday night at Signaigo Field, evnetually handing the Christian Brothers University Bucs a 2-1 defeat in the Bucs' season opener.
HOW IT HAPPENED:
•
Brendan Bennett (Belfast, Northern Ireland/St. Mary's Christian Brothers Grammar School) opened the scoring in the 80th minute, scoring an unassisted goal just seconds after he subbed back into the game to put the Bucs (0-1-0) on the board.
• The Scots (1-1-1) equalized in the 90th minute as Arne Meyer scored unassisted to force overtime.
• After the Bucs had two shots saved in the first minutes of overtime, Lyon's Omar Fabila scored unassisted in the 98th minute for the golden goal.
KEY STATS:
• The Bucs out-shot Lyon 12-8 for the game, including a 5-3 edge in shots on goal.
